Emergency Plumbing Service in Quakertown, PA

A sewer line blocked by tree root infiltration in Quakertown doesn't clear with a plunger or store-bought drain cleaner. Root masses in a sewer line require professional cutting equipment โ€” either a mechanical rooter or hydro jetting โ€” to clear the blockage and restore flow. Beyond clearing, root intrusion events require camera inspection to assess the extent of root growth and whether the line has structural damage at the infiltration points. We respond to root-related sewer emergencies throughout Bucks County and provide a clear picture of the immediate fix and long-term prognosis.

Clogged Drains in Quakertown? We Fix Them.

A basement floor drain that starts backing up in a Quakertown home is telling you something specific: either the drain itself is blocked at the trap or further in the line, or the sewer system beneath the house is under backpressure from a main line issue or municipal backup event. The distinction matters because the response is different. A drain-local blockage is cleared at the drain. A backpressure situation requires main line assessment and may not be fixable at the drain level โ€” it may require a backflow preventer (check valve) on the floor drain to prevent future sewage backup from rising through that lowest-point opening. We assess floor drain backup situations throughout Bucks County accurately before recommending the appropriate solution.

Sewer Problems in Quakertown? Camera Inspection First.

Trenchless sewer rehabilitation has changed the cost profile of sewer line repair in Quakertown significantly. Pipe lining (CIPP) inserts a resin-saturated liner into the existing pipe, cures it in place, and leaves a structural new pipe inside the old one โ€” without excavation. Pipe bursting pushes a new pipe through the path of the old one, displacing it outward. Both methods restore full function with minimal disturbance to landscaping and hardscape. We assess Bucks County sewer lines via camera first to determine which approach โ€” or conventional open-trench โ€” is appropriate for the specific conditions.

Plumbing Maintenance Tips for Quakertown Residents

Homes in Quakertown built before 1970 may contain plumbing materials that are at or past their service life: galvanized steel supply pipes that have been corroding from the inside for decades, cast iron drain lines that are cracked or separated at joints, and in some older homes, lead service lines from the street to the house. We assess older plumbing systems throughout Bucks County and give homeowners a clear picture of what they have, what's at risk, and a realistic timeline for addressing aging infrastructure before it fails. A proactive repipe is always less expensive and disruptive than an emergency pipe failure.

  • Know your main shutoff location โ€” Before any emergency occurs, locate your main water shutoff valve and ensure every adult in the household knows how to operate it quickly. This single step can prevent thousands of dollars in water damage when a pipe fails unexpectedly.
  • Act on early warning signs โ€” Slow drains, low water pressure, discolored water, and unexpectedly high water bills are early indicators of developing problems. Addressing them early is almost always less expensive than waiting for a failure.
  • Schedule annual water heater maintenance โ€” Flushing sediment, inspecting the anode rod, and testing the pressure relief valve annually can add 3โ€“5 years to your water heater's service life and prevent the most common failure modes.
  • Inspect outdoor plumbing seasonally โ€” Pennsylvania's cold winters with hard freeze risk throughout creates specific stress points for outdoor hose bibs, exposed pipe runs, and irrigation systems. A brief seasonal inspection prevents the most common weather-related plumbing failures in Quakertown homes.
